WebMost sharks swallow their food whole or bite it into relatively large pieces. Sharks have U-shaped stomachs that use very strong acids and enzymes to dissolve most of what is eaten. WebFeb 18, 2024 · The white shark is born at approximately 4 feet long and can grow up to about 20 feet long, weighing over 4,000 pounds. The white shark has a diverse and opportunistic diet of fish, invertebrates, and marine mammals. WebSep 5, 2024 · Sharks, in particular hammerheads, often have spines in their digestive tracts and imbedded in their jaws from feeding on stingrays. What do rays and skates feed on? The majority of rays and skates feed on bottom dwelling (benthic) animals including shrimps, crabs, oysters, clams and other invertebrates.

WebFeb 9, 2024 · Another way that sharks may consume their food is through filter feeding. This involves filtering large amounts of water through the gills and using specially adapted structures such as gill rakers to capture prey particles from the water column. Filter feeding typically occurs with planktonic organisms like krill or small schooling fishes.

Nurse sharks are known to feed on small fishes and invertebrates such as shrimps, crabs, sea urchins, spiny lobsters, and squids. As they reach adulthood, their prey includes sea turtles, seals, sea lions, porpoises, dolphins, and small whales.
